How to Make BBQ Sauce

Learn how to make BBQ Sauce from scratch with simple grocery ingredients. Use this easy base recipe and then spice it up any way you like!

Ingredients

  • 2 tablespoons vegetable oil
  • 2 teaspoons minced garlic 
  • 1 1/2 cups ketchup
  • 1 cup apple cider vinegar
  • 1/2 cup brown sugar
  • 1/3 cup Worcestershire sauce 
  • 3 tablespoons yellow mustard
  • 1 1/2 tablespoons soy sauce
  • 1 teaspoon chili powder
  • Tabasco sauce to taste

Instructions

  1. In a medium saucepan over medium-high heat, warm the vegetable oil. Add the garlic and cook for 1 minute.
  2. Add the remaining sauce ingredients and bring to a boil. Reduce heat and simmer about 15 minutes.
  3. Cool and and use with your favorite BBQ dishes. Refigerate any leftovers.
